کتاب PostgreSQL 14 Administration Cookbook

جزئیات بیشتر و خرید محصول:

۲۴,۰۰۰ تومان

توضیحات

کتاب PostgreSQL 14 Administration Cookbook با نام کامل راهنمای مدیریت PostgreSQL 14: بیش از 175 دستور العمل ثابت شده برای مدیران پایگاه داده برای مدیریت مؤثر پایگاه داده‌های سازمانی، نسخه 3 یک کتاب فوق‌العاده برای یادگیری نسخه ۱۴ پایگاه داده PostgreSQL است که از مقدمات تا نکات پیشرفته‌ی این پایگاه داده قدرتمند را آموزش می‌دهد.

مقدمه‌ای بر کتاب PostgreSQL 14 Administration Cookbook:

PostgreSQL یک سیستم مدیریت پایگاه داده منبع باز قدرتمند با شهرت رشک برانگیز برای عملکرد و پایداری بالا است. با بسیاری از ویژگی‌های جدید در سیستم خود، PostgreSQL 14 به شما امکان می‌دهد زیرساخت PostgreSQL خود را افزایش دهید. با این کتاب، یک رویکرد گام‌به‌گام و مبتنی بر دستور العمل برای مدیریت مؤثر PostgreSQL در پیش خواهید گرفت.

کتاب PostgreSQL 14 Administration Cookbook شما را با آخرین ویژگی‌های PostgreSQL 14 راه‌اندازی می‌کند و در عین حال به شما کمک می‌کند کل اکوسیستم پایگاه داده را کشف کنید. شما یاد خواهید گرفت که چگونه به انواع مشکلات و نقاط دردناکی که ممکن است به عنوان مدیر پایگاه داده با آن‌ها مواجه شوید، از قبیل ایجاد جداول، مدیریت نماها، بهبود عملکرد و ایمن‌سازی پایگاه داده خود، مقابله کنید.

همانطور که پیشرفت می‌کنید، کتاب توجه را به موضوعات مهمی مانند نقش‌های نظارتی، تأیید اعتبار پشتیبان گیری، نگهداری منظم و بازیابی پایگاه داده PostgreSQL 14 شما جلب می‌کند. این به شما کمک می‌کند نقش‌ها را درک کنید و از دسترسی بالا، همزمانی و تکرار اطمینان حاصل کنید. همراه با دستور العمل‌های به روز شده، این کتاب به حوزه‌های مهمی مانند استفاده از ستون‌های تولید شده، فشرده‌سازی TOAST، PostgreSQL در ابر و موارد دیگر می‌پردازد.

در پایان این کتاب PostgreSQL، دانشی را که برای مدیریت کارآمد پایگاه داده PostgreSQL 14 خود، چه در فضای ابری و چه در فضای داخلی، نیاز دارید، به دست خواهید آورد.

کتاب PostgreSQL 14 Administration Cookbook برای چه کسی است؟

این کتاب Postgres 14 برای مدیران پایگاه داده، معماران داده، توسعه‌دهندگان پایگاه داده، و هر کسی که علاقه مند به برنامه ریزی و اجرای پایگاه داده‌های تولید زنده با استفاده از PostgreSQL 14 است. کسانی که به دنبال راه حل‌های عملی برای هر مشکل مرتبط با مدیریت PostgreSQL 14 هستند، این را نیز خواهند یافت. کتاب مفید برخی از تجربیات مربوط به مدیریت پایگاه‌های داده PostgreSQL به شما کمک می‌کند تا از این کتاب نهایت استفاده را ببرید، با این حال، حتی اگر تازه سفر Postgres خود را آغاز کرده‌اید، منبع مفیدی است.

بیشتر بخوانید: کتاب PostgreSQL Query Optimization

آنچه این کتاب پوشش می‌دهد:

فصل 1، مراحل اول، شما را با PostgreSQL 14 آشنا می‌کند. نحوه دانلود و نصب PostgreSQL 14، اتصال به سرور PostgreSQL، فعال کردن دسترسی سرور به شبکه یا کاربران راه دور، استفاده از ابزارهای مدیریت گرافیکی، استفاده از ابزارهای پرس و جو و اسکریپت PSQL، تغییر ایمن رمز عبور، اجتناب از کدگذاری سخت رمز عبور، استفاده از فایل سرویس اتصال، و عیب یابی اتصال ناموفق. این فصل همچنین نحوه دسترسی به PostgreSQL در فضای ابری را پوشش می‌دهد.

فصل 2 کتاب PostgreSQL 14 Administration Cookbook، کاوش در پایگاه داده، نحوه شناسایی نسخه سرور پایگاه داده‌ای که استفاده می‌کنید و همچنین زمان کارکرد سرور را نشان می‌دهد. این به شما کمک می‌کند تا فایل‌های سرور پایگاه داده، گزارش پیام سرور پایگاه داده و شناسه سیستم پایگاه داده را پیدا کنید.

توضیح می‌دهد که چگونه یک پایگاه داده را در سرور پایگاه داده فهرست کنید، و حاوی دستور العمل‌هایی است که به شما امکان می‌دهد از تعداد جداول در پایگاه داده خود، چه مقدار فضای دیسک توسط پایگاه داده و جداول استفاده می‌شود، بزرگترین جداول، چند ردیف و تعداد ردیف‌ها مطلع شوید. جدول، نحوه تخمین سطرها در جدول و نحوه درک وابستگی‌های شیء را دارد.

فصل 3 کتاب PostgreSQL 14 Administration Cookbook، پیکربندی سرور، موضوعاتی مانند خواندن کتابچه راهنمای خوب (RTFM)، نحوه برنامه ریزی یک پایگاه داده جدید، نحوه تغییر پارامترها در برنامه‌های خود، تنظیمات پیکربندی فعلی، پارامترهایی که در تنظیمات غیر پیش فرض قرار دارند، توضیح می‌دهد. برای به روز رسانی فایل پارامتر، نحوه تنظیم پارامترها برای گروه‌های خاصی از کاربران، چک لیست اصلی پیکربندی سرور، نحوه افزودن یک ماژول خارجی به سرور PostgreSQL، و نحوه اجرای سرور در حالت صرفه‌جویی در مصرف انرژی.

فصل 4 کتاب PostgreSQL 14 Administration Cookbook، کنترل سرور، اطلاعاتی در مورد راه اندازی سرور پایگاه داده به صورت دستی، توقف سریع و ایمن سرور، توقف سرور در مواقع اضطراری، بارگیری مجدد فایل‌های پیکربندی سرور، راه‌اندازی مجدد سریع سرور، جلوگیری از اتصالات جدید، محدود کردن کاربران به تنها یک جلسه ارائه می‌دهد.

هر کدام، و حذف کاربران از سیستم. این شامل دستور العمل‌هایی است که به شما کمک می‌کند طرحی را برای چند اجاره ای انتخاب کنید، و همچنین دستور العمل‌هایی که نحوه استفاده از طرحواره‌های متعدد را توضیح می‌دهد، به کاربران پایگاه داده خصوصی خود را ارائه می‌دهد، چندین سرور پایگاه داده را در یک سیستم اجرا می‌کند و یک استخر اتصال راه‌اندازی می‌کند.

فصل 4 کتاب PostgreSQL 14 Administration Cookbook نسخه 3

فصل 5 کتاب PostgreSQL 14 Administration Cookbook، جداول و داده‌ها، شما را در فرآیند انتخاب نام خوب برای اشیاء پایگاه داده راهنمایی می‌کند. علاوه بر این، نحوه مدیریت اشیاء با نام‌های نقل‌شده، اعمال نام یکسان، حفظ همان تعریف برای ستون‌ها، شناسایی و حذف ردیف‌های تکراری، جلوگیری از تکرار ردیف‌ها، یافتن یک کلید منحصر به فرد برای مجموعه‌ای از داده‌ها، تولید داده‌های آزمایشی، نمونه‌برداری تصادفی توضیح می‌دهد. داده‌ها را از صفحه گسترده و فایل‌های مسطح بارگیری کنید.

فصل 6 کتاب PostgreSQL 14 Administration Cookbook، امنیت، دستور العمل‌هایی در مورد لغو دسترسی کاربر به جدول، اعطای دسترسی کاربر به جدول، ایجاد یک کاربر جدید، جلوگیری موقت از اتصال کاربر، حذف کاربر بدون حذف داده‌هایش، بررسی اینکه آیا همه کاربران یک رمز عبور امن دارند یا خیر، ارائه می‌دهد. اعطای اختیارات محدود ابرکاربر به کاربران خاص، ممیزی تغییرات DDL، ممیزی تغییرات داده‌ها، ادغام با LDAP، اتصال با استفاده از SSL، و رمزگذاری داده‌های حساس.

فصل 7 کتاب PostgreSQL 14 Administration Cookbook، مدیریت پایگاه داده، دستور العمل‌هایی را در مورد موضوعات مفیدی مانند نوشتن یک اسکریپت که در آن همه موفق یا ناموفق هستند، نوشتن یک اسکریپت psql که در اولین خطا خارج می‌شود، انجام اقدامات روی بسیاری از جداول، اضافه کردن و حذف ستون‌ها در جداول، تغییر داده‌ها ارائه می‌دهد. نوع ستون، اضافه کردن و حذف طرحواره‌ها، جابجایی اشیا بین طرحواره‌ها، افزودن و حذف فضاهای جدول، جابجایی اشیاء بین فضاهای جدول، دسترسی به اشیاء در پایگاه داده‌های دیگر PostgreSQL و امکان به روز رسانی نماها.

فصل 8 کتاب PostgreSQL 14 Administration Cookbook، نظارت و تشخیص، دستور العمل‌هایی را ارائه می‌دهد که به سؤالاتی پاسخ می‌دهد مانند اینکه آیا کاربر متصل است، چه چیزی در حال اجرا است، آیا فعال است یا مسدود شده است، چه کسی توسط چه کسی مسدود شده است، آیا کسی از یک جدول خاص استفاده می‌کند یا نه، زمانی که جدول.

آخرین‌بار استفاده شده است، چه مقدار فضای دیسک توسط داده‌های موقت استفاده می‌شود، و چرا جستجوهای شما ممکن است کند شود. همچنین نحوه بررسی و گزارش یک اشکال، تهیه گزارش خلاصه روزانه از خطاهای فایل لاگ، کشتن یک جلسه خاص، و حل یک تراکنش آماده شده در شک را نشان می‌دهد.

فصل 8 کتاب PostgreSQL 14 Administration Cookbook نسخه 3

فصل 9 کتاب PostgreSQL 14 Administration Cookbook، تعمیر و نگهداری منظم، دستور العمل‌های مفیدی در مورد نحوه کنترل تعمیر و نگهداری خودکار پایگاه داده، جلوگیری از انسداد خودکار و خرابی صفحه، جلوگیری از پیچیدگی تراکنش‌ها، حذف تراکنش‌های آماده شده قدیمی، ارائه راه حل‌هایی برای کاربران سنگین جداول موقت، شناسایی و تعمیر جداول و نمایه‌های متورم ارائه می‌دهد. نمایه‌ها را حفظ کنید، نمایه‌های استفاده نشده را پیدا کنید، نمایه‌های ناخواسته را با دقت حذف کنید، و برای نگهداری برنامه‌ریزی کنید.

فصل 10 کتاب PostgreSQL 14 Administration Cookbook، عملکرد و همزمانی، موضوعاتی مانند نحوه یافتن عبارات SQL کند، جمع‌آوری آمار منظم از نماهای pg_stat*، کشف عواملی که SQL را کند می‌کند، کاهش تعداد ردیف‌های برگشتی، ساده‌سازی SQL پیچیده، سرعت بخشیدن به پرس‌و‌جوها بدون بازنویسی آن‌ها را پوشش می‌دهد.

درک کنید که چرا برخی از پرس و جوها از ایندکس استفاده نمی‌کنند، پرس و جو را مجبور به استفاده از ایندکس کنید، از قفل خوش‌بینانه استفاده کنید و مشکلات عملکرد را گزارش کنید. و البته، در مورد ویژگی‌های جدید پرس و جوی موازی، نمونه جدول و پارتیشن بندی سری زمانی یاد خواهید گرفت.

فصل 11 کتاب PostgreSQL 14 Administration Cookbook، پشتیبان‌گیری و بازیابی، توضیح می‌دهد که پشتیبان‌گیری ضروری است، اگرچه این موضوع فقط به طور خلاصه توضیح داده شده است. بنابراین، این فصل اطلاعات مفیدی در مورد پشتیبان‌گیری و بازیابی پایگاه داده PostgreSQL شما از طریق دستور العمل‌هایی در مورد نحوه درک و کنترل بازیابی خرابی و نحوه برنامه‌ریزی پشتیبان ارائه می‌دهد.

علاوه بر این، در مورد پشتیبان‌گیری منطقی داغ از یک پایگاه داده، پشتیبان‌گیری منطقی داغ از همه پایگاه‌های داده، پشتیبان‌گیری منطقی داغ از همه جداول در یک جدول، پشتیبان‌گیری از تعاریف شی پایگاه داده، پشتیبان‌گیری از پایگاه داده فیزیکی داغ مستقل، نسخه پشتیبان‌گیری از پایگاه داده فیزیکی داغ یاد خواهید گرفت.

پشتیبان‌گیری و بایگانی مداوم همچنین شامل موضوعاتی مانند بازیابی همه پایگاه‌های داده، بازیابی در یک نقطه از زمان، بازیابی جدول حذف شده یا آسیب دیده، بازیابی پایگاه داده حذف شده یا آسیب دیده، بازیابی فضای جدول حذف شده یا آسیب دیده، نحوه بهبود عملکرد پشتیبان‌گیری/بازیابی، و پشتیبان‌گیری و بازیابی افزایشی/دیفرانسیل.

فصل 12 کتاب PostgreSQL 14 Administration Cookbook، تکرار و ارتقاء، توضیح می‌دهد که تکرار جادو نیست، اگرچه می‌تواند بسیار جالب باشد. وقتی کار می‌کند حتی خنک‌تر می‌شود، و این همان چیزی است که این فصل درباره آن است.

این فصل مفاهیم تکرار، بهترین شیوه‌های تکرار، نحوه راه‌اندازی تکرار ارسال گزارش مبتنی بر فایل، نحوه تنظیم تکرار گزارش جریان، نحوه مدیریت تکرار ارسال گزارش، نحوه مدیریت آماده‌باش داغ، تکرار همزمان، نحوه ارتقاء به نسخه جدید جزئی، ارتقاء اصلی در محل، ارتقاء عمده آنلاین، و تکرار منطقی و Postgres-BDR.

فصل 12 کتاب PostgreSQL 14 Administration Cookbook نسخه 3

سرفصل‌های کتاب PostgreSQL 14 Administration Cookbook:

  • Preface
  • Chapter 1: First Steps
  • Chapter 2: Exploring the Database
  • Chapter 3: Server Configuration
  • Chapter 4: Server Control
  • Chapter 5: Tables and Data
  • Chapter 6: Security
  • Chapter 7: Database Administration
  • Chapter 8: Monitoring and Diagnosis
  • Chapter 9: Regular Maintenance
  • Chapter 10: Performance and Concurrency
  • Chapter 11: Backup and Recovery
  • Chapter 12: Replication and Upgrades

فایل کتاب PostgreSQL 14 Administration Cookbook را می‌توانید پس از پرداخت، دریافت کنید.

توضیحات تکمیلی

فرمت کتاب

PDF

ویرایش

Third

ISBN

978-1-80324-897-4

تعداد صفحات

608

انتشارات

Packt

سال انتشار

حجم

نویسنده

,

هیچ دیدگاهی برای این محصول نوشته نشده است.

اشتراک‌گذاری:

دیگر محصولات:

نماد اعتبار ما:

آدرس: اصفهان، فلکه ارتش

 

پشتیبانی از ساعت 18 تا 22: 09392868101

© کليه حقوق محصولات و محتوای اين سایت متعلق به مدیر سایت می‌باشد و هر گونه کپی‌برداری از محتوا و محصولات سایت پیگرد قانونی دارد.